The third annual Women Veterans Conference will take place from October 3 to 5 at the Four Points by Sheraton Detroit, located at 27000 S. Karevich Drive. This year’s event is expected to be a vibrant celebration, honoring not only those who have served but also those currently serving and everyone who supports women veterans throughout the state.
The conference promises to be a mix of insightful speakers, interactive activities, and opportunities to advocate for women veterans. Attending this gathering provides a chance to connect with fellow veterans and supporters, making it a valuable experience for everyone involved. Admission for women veterans is set at $30. In addition to exciting conferences, the Michigan Veterans Affairs Agency (MVAA) is actively seeking applications from nonprofit organizations for the Fiscal Year 2025 Michigan Veteran Homelessness Prevention Grant. With up to $2.5 million available, this funding aims to help Michigan-based nonprofits that support service members, veterans, and their families facing homelessness. Grants can go up to $250,000 each, providing much-needed assistance for programs aimed at finding sustainable housing solutions for veterans in distress.
The funds will target initiatives that not only offer immediate relief but also create long-term solutions. This might include temporary housing options, renovation projects for affordable units, and programs incentivizing landlords to accommodate veterans. If your organization is interested in applying, make sure to send a Letter of Intent to MVAAGrants@michigan.gov by September 19, with final applications due by September 30. A video informational meeting about the grants is scheduled for September 23, making it a great opportunity to learn more about this vital funding.
Moreover, the community is buzzing with various events aimed at uniting and entertaining veterans. Holly American Legion Post 149 is hosting a Line Dancing Class on September 23 and an exciting Holly Dancing Witches event on September 26. For those interested in games, Oxford American Legion Post 108 will have a fun-filled Euchre night, followed by multiple themed buffet nights throughout the week.
If bingo is more your forte, head over to Clarkston American Legion Post 377 for a lively bingo night or check out Royal Oak American Legion Post 253 for an Oktoberfest celebration filled with food, music, and raffles. These friendly gatherings are all about community and support for the brave men and women who have worn the uniform.
Lastly, on September 28, the Holly Area Veterans Resource Center will host a Forum for Women Veterans, featuring a complimentary luncheon and an engaging program filled with speakers and panel discussions. This event is open to all female veterans, providing a wonderful platform for networking and sharing experiences.
